Course Details

Family Health Assessment: An overview of the process and methods for assessing the health status and needs of families, including data collection, analysis, and interpretation.
Health Monitoring Tools: Introduction to various tools and techniques used for monitoring family health, such as surveys, interviews, and health assessments.
Health Promotion Strategies: Exploration of evidence-based strategies for promoting family health, including health education, counseling, and community engagement.
Chronic Disease Management: Examination of best practices for managing chronic diseases within families, including self-management, medication adherence, and lifestyle modifications.
Mental Health and Family Dynamics: Analysis of the impact of mental health on family functioning and strategies for promoting mental well-being within families.
Child and Adolescent Health: Overview of the unique health needs and challenges faced by children and adolescents, and best practices for promoting their health and well-being.
Family Health Policy and Advocacy: Examination of the policy landscape surrounding family health, including key stakeholders, advocacy strategies, and policy analysis.
Cultural Competence in Family Health: Exploration of cultural diversity and its impact on family health, including strategies for providing culturally sensitive care and engaging diverse communities in health promotion efforts.
Research Methods in Family Health: Overview of research methods and study designs commonly used in family health research, including survey research, qualitative methods, and experimental designs.
